I refer to the pilot process used by the Education Department to identify refinements and enhancements needed to the software provided by RM Australasia Pty Ltd. (1) Will the report of this process be tabled? (2) If not, why not? (3) Will the comprehensive list of refinements and enhancements be tabled? (4) If not, why not? Hon BARRY HOUSE
AnswerView source ↗
I thank the member for some notice of this question. I ask that it be placed on notice.
